The Lunar Divide: How Moon Signs Define the Emotional Landscapes of Twins

The phenomenon of twins in astrology presents a fascinating paradox. While the world often perceives twins as mirror images, sharing the same DNA and the same birth date, the astrological reality is far more nuanced. The core of this nuance lies in the Moon sign, a celestial factor that can shift dramatically within the brief interval between the births of two siblings. Unlike the Sun sign, which changes slowly over the course of a month, the Moon traverses the zodiac in approximately 27.3 days, moving roughly 12 to 13 degrees per day. This rapid movement means that even a difference of a few minutes in birth time can result in the Moon occupying a different sign, house, or phase in the birth chart of each twin. This subtle yet profound difference in the Moon's position creates distinct emotional landscapes, fundamentally altering how each twin experiences their inner world, their instincts, and their relationship with one another.

The Moon in astrology governs the emotional self, representing instincts, subconscious tendencies, and the need for security. It is the architect of our emotional responses and the lens through which we nurture and care for ourselves and others. When twins share the same Sun sign but possess different Moon signs, the divergence in their emotional makeup becomes the defining feature of their individual identities. One twin may possess a Moon in a water sign, characterized by sensitivity and intuition, while the other may have a Moon in a fire sign, marked by assertiveness and passion. These divergent emotional architectures explain why twins, despite their shared origins, often grow up with radically different temperaments, life choices, and interpersonal dynamics.

The mechanism behind this divergence is rooted in the precise timing of birth. Since the Moon changes signs approximately every two and a half days, the window in which it transitions from one sign to the next is narrow. If Twin A is born just before the Moon changes sign, and Twin B is born just after, their entire emotional foundations are altered. This is not merely a minor variation; it is a fundamental shift in the "emotional blueprint" of the individual. The Moon's position also dictates the "emotional house" in which the Moon resides. Even if the Moon remains in the same sign, a shift of a few minutes can move the Moon from the 1st house (self-identity) to the 2nd house (values and resources) or the 12th house (subconscious), drastically changing how that emotional energy is expressed in daily life.

The Role of the Ascendant and Rising Sign

While the Moon governs the inner emotional world, the Rising sign, or Ascendant, governs the "mask" presented to the world. For twins, the Ascendant can vary significantly even if the Sun and Moon signs are shared. The Ascendant is the zodiac sign rising on the eastern horizon at the exact moment of birth. Because the Earth rotates, the Ascendant changes roughly every two hours. This means twins born minutes apart can easily have different Rising signs.

For example, if one twin has a Leo Rising and the other has a Virgo Rising, their outward personalities and the first impression they make on others will differ. A Leo Rising projects confidence, charisma, and leadership, appearing natural-born leaders. A Virgo Rising, conversely, appears analytical, precise, and service-oriented. This difference in the "mask" means that even if two twins share the same inner emotional makeup (Moon sign), the world perceives them differently. One may be seen as the bold, charismatic figure, while the other is seen as the meticulous, detail-oriented partner. This divergence in the Rising sign adds another layer of complexity to the twin dynamic, explaining why one twin might be the "face" of the partnership while the other is the "engine."

The interplay between the Moon sign and the Rising sign is critical. If a twin has a Cancer Moon and a Leo Rising, the emotional sensitivity of Cancer is filtered through the confident exterior of Leo. If the other twin has a Capricorn Moon and a Virgo Rising, the emotional restraint of Capricorn is expressed through the analytical precision of Virgo. This combination of Moon and Rising signs creates a unique personality profile for each twin, ensuring that despite their shared birth date, their interactions with the world are distinctly different.
